A tech solutions company in Miri, Malaysia, is seeking a Development Executive to design and maintain software applications and IT infrastructure. This role involves full participation in the Software Development Life Cycle, user support, and collaboration with internal teams. The ideal candidate holds a diploma or degree in IT with at least 3 years of experience in software development. Knowledge in web programming and strong problem-solving skills are essential. Competitive compensation and growth opportunities are offered.
Responsible for designing, developing, and maintaining software applications and IT infrastructure in alignment with organizational goals. This role actively participates in all stages of the Software Development Life Cycle (SDLC) while ensuring systems remain optimized, secure, and scalable. It also involves troubleshooting, testing, documentation, and providing technical support for both software and hardware systems. Education: Diploma / Degree / Certificate in IT, Computer Science, Software Engineering, or related field.
Experience: Minimum 3 years of experience in software development.
Languages: Fluent in English; proficiency in Bahasa Malaysia and Mandarin is an added advantage.
